How to fill out three month bail bond

How to fill out three month bail bond
01
Contact a reputable bail bond agent or company.
02
Provide the necessary information such as the defendant's name, the location of the jail, and the amount of bail.
03
Pay the premium, which is typically 10% of the total bail amount.
04
Sign the necessary paperwork and agree to meet any conditions set by the bail bond agent.
05
Keep track of court dates and make sure the defendant appears in court.
